summ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orHenri Sara <henri.sara@itmill.com>2010-10-04 07:58:55 +0000
committerHenri Sara <henri.sara@itmill.com>2010-10-04 07:58:55 +0000
commitb12e07b39a8b82b87db630b5c11f2aedaf050d54 (patch)
tree298a1d49786d49409d0c1212d98611ab85c5c52e /src
parent0b35214df4802c553a5882cfce34fecaa5bc8f25 (diff)
downloadvaadin-framework-b12e07b39a8b82b87db630b5c11f2aedaf050d54.tar.gz
vaadin-framework-b12e07b39a8b82b87db630b5c11f2aedaf050d54.zip
#5692 Generics: KeyMapper
svn changeset:15324/svn branch:6.5
Diffstat (limited to 'src')
-rw-r--r--src/com/vaadin/terminal/KeyMapper.java8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/com/vaadin/terminal/KeyMapper.java b/src/com/vaadin/terminal/KeyMapper.java
index 706b5d27e7..b0ab3c2ffe 100644
--- a/src/com/vaadin/terminal/KeyMapper.java
+++ b/src/com/vaadin/terminal/KeyMapper.java
@@ -21,9 +21,9 @@ public class KeyMapper implements Serializable {
private int lastKey = 0;
- private final Hashtable objectKeyMap = new Hashtable();
+ private final Hashtable<Object, String> objectKeyMap = new Hashtable<Object, String>();
- private final Hashtable keyObjectMap = new Hashtable();
+ private final Hashtable<String, Object> keyObjectMap = new Hashtable<String, Object>();
/**
* Gets key for an object.
@@ -38,7 +38,7 @@ public class KeyMapper implements Serializable {
}
// If the object is already mapped, use existing key
- String key = (String) objectKeyMap.get(o);
+ String key = objectKeyMap.get(o);
if (key != null) {
return key;
}
@@ -70,7 +70,7 @@ public class KeyMapper implements Serializable {
* the object to be removed.
*/
public void remove(Object removeobj) {
- final String key = (String) objectKeyMap.get(removeobj);
+ final String key = objectKeyMap.get(removeobj);
if (key != null) {
objectKeyMap.remove(key);